Assistant/Associate Professor of Education and Director of Clinical Practice
Job Summary
Job ID 296612
Position # 40106164
Augusta University's College of Education and Human Development is seeking a non-tenure track faculty member at the rank of Assistant or Associate Professor to serve as the Director of Clinical Practice for educator and other school personnel preparation. We are looking for an innovative self-starter to establish and maintain a collaborative culture within the office of field experience and across the College and with community partners. We have students that need field experiences year round and placements need to be made. It is an accreditation requirement. This position reports to the Dean of the College.
Responsibilities
Teaching - 10%
- Develop and deliver undergraduate and/or graduate courses related to clinical practice and educator preparation.
- Supervise students in culminating residency and other clinical experiences (reduced instructional load commensurate with administrative responsibilities).
- Deliver instruction in online synchronous and asynchronous formats.
- Collaborate with faculty to ensure alignment between coursework and clinical experiences.
Administration - 70%
- Serve as Director of Clinical Practice/Clinical Placements for the College.
- Develop and sustain partnerships with P-12 schools, districts, and other placement sites.
- Coordinate clinical placements in alignment with program requirements, licensure standards, and accreditation expectations.
- Serve as a primary liaison among faculty, staff, students, and external partners related to clinical practice.
- Oversee processes, timelines, communication, and documentation related to clinical placements and supervision.
Research / Scholarly Activity - 10%
- Engage in scholarly, applied research, or professional activities related to educator preparation, clinical practice, supervision, partnerships, or program improvement.
- Supervise or support scholarly dissemination or program evaluation efforts appropriate to a non-tenure-track appointment.
Service - 10%
- Provide service to the department, College, and University through committee participation and leadership.
- Support accreditation, assessment, and continuous improvement efforts.
- Engage in service activities that support the profession and community partnerships.
